Why does a hormone only act on specific cell types in an organism and not others?
Vilka [71]

Answer:

c) A cell must have the appropriate receptor before it can bind to the hormone.

Explanation:

Hormones are chemical signals that are secreted into the circulatory system acting as regulators within the body, and even though they can reach any part on the body, <em>only certain types of cells are equipped to respond, these cells are known as target cells, when the hormone reaches a cell with an adequate receptors it triggers a signal transduction and then a response.</em>

Therefore the correct answer is c.
